编程一般属于什么部门管

worktile 其他 35

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程一般属于信息技术部门管辖。

    在大多数组织和企业中,编程被视为信息技术(IT)部门的核心职责之一。信息技术部门负责管理和维护组织的计算机系统、软件应用程序和网络基础设施。编程作为一种技术活动,是实现和开发软件应用程序的核心环节,因此通常由信息技术部门负责。

    信息技术部门通常由一群专业的技术人员组成,包括软件工程师、系统管理员、数据库管理员等。他们负责编写、测试、维护和优化软件程序,确保系统的正常运行和数据的安全性。此外,他们还负责与其他部门合作,根据业务需求开发定制的软件解决方案。

    编程在现代组织中起着重要的作用,几乎涉及到各个行业和领域。无论是金融、医疗、零售还是制造业,都离不开编程的支持。因此,信息技术部门在组织中扮演着至关重要的角色,负责确保软件应用程序的开发和维护工作能够顺利进行。

    综上所述,编程一般属于信息技术部门管辖,这是为了确保组织的计算机系统和软件应用程序能够正常运行,满足业务需求。信息技术部门的工作人员负责编写、测试和维护软件程序,以支持组织的各项业务活动。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程一般属于技术部门管。在大多数组织和公司中,技术部门负责开发和维护软件应用程序、网站和其他技术解决方案。编程是技术部门的核心职责之一。技术部门通常由软件工程师、系统工程师、网络工程师等技术专业人员组成,他们使用编程语言和工具来开发和实施各种技术解决方案。

    以下是关于编程所属部门的更详细解释:

    1. 研发部门:许多公司和组织拥有专门的研发部门,负责开发新的软件产品或更新现有产品。这些部门通常由软件工程师组成,他们使用编程语言和开发工具来编写、测试和部署软件代码。

    2. IT部门:IT部门负责维护和管理组织的信息技术基础设施。这包括网络、服务器、数据库和其他技术系统。编程在IT部门中起着重要的作用,用于编写自动化脚本、管理网络设备和开发内部工具。

    3. 网络部门:网络部门负责设计、配置和维护组织的网络基础设施。网络工程师使用编程来编写脚本和配置文件,以自动化网络设备的管理和配置。

    4. 数据科学部门:在数据驱动的时代,许多组织都设立了数据科学部门,负责分析和利用组织的数据资产。数据科学家使用编程语言和工具来开发模型、进行数据挖掘和机器学习,以提供有关业务的见解和决策支持。

    5. 网站和应用开发部门:许多公司都有专门的网站和应用开发部门,负责设计、开发和维护公司网站和移动应用程序。这些部门通常由前端开发人员、后端开发人员和UI/UX设计师组成,他们使用编程语言和框架来实现用户界面和功能。

    总的来说,编程涉及到许多不同的部门和角色,包括研发部门、IT部门、网络部门、数据科学部门和网站应用开发部门等。具体归属于哪个部门取决于组织的结构和业务需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程一般属于信息技术部门或者研发部门管辖。在大多数组织中,信息技术部门负责管理和支持计算机系统、网络和软件应用程序的开发、维护和运营。而研发部门则专注于产品和技术的研究与开发。这两个部门通常紧密合作,共同推动组织的技术创新和发展。

    下面将从编程的方法和操作流程两个方面,详细讲解编程的内容。

    一、编程的方法

    1. 面向过程编程:面向过程编程是一种以过程为中心的编程范式,程序按照步骤顺序执行。这种编程方法适用于简单的、线性的问题,通过将问题分解为一系列的步骤,然后按照顺序执行这些步骤来解决问题。

    2. 面向对象编程:面向对象编程是一种以对象为中心的编程范式,程序由多个对象组成,每个对象都有自己的属性和方法。这种编程方法适用于复杂的、具有多个对象之间相互交互的问题,通过定义对象的属性和方法,以及对象之间的关系,来解决问题。

    3. 函数式编程:函数式编程是一种将计算视为函数求值的编程范式,强调函数的纯粹性和无副作用。这种编程方法适用于并行计算和处理大量数据的场景,通过将问题分解为一系列的函数,然后将这些函数组合起来来解决问题。

    二、编程的操作流程

    1. 分析需求:首先,需要明确编程的目标和需求,了解要解决的问题是什么,以及需要达到的效果是什么。

    2. 设计算法:根据需求,设计合适的算法来解决问题。算法是解决问题的步骤和方法的描述,它描述了程序的执行流程。

    3. 编写代码:根据设计好的算法,使用编程语言编写代码。代码是算法的具体实现,包括变量的定义、函数的编写和逻辑的表达等。

    4. 调试测试:编写完代码后,需要进行调试和测试。调试是指在程序运行过程中检查和修复错误,测试是指验证程序的正确性和稳定性。

    5. 优化改进:根据测试结果,对程序进行优化和改进。优化是指提高程序的性能和效率,改进是指修复程序的缺陷和改进用户体验。

    6. 部署上线:经过测试和优化后,将程序部署到生产环境中,供用户使用。部署是指将程序安装到服务器或者客户端,上线是指将程序对外开放,让用户可以使用。

    7. 维护更新:一旦程序上线,就需要进行维护和更新。维护是指监控和管理程序的运行状态,更新是指根据需求和反馈,对程序进行功能扩展和改进。

    综上所述,编程一般属于信息技术部门或者研发部门管辖。编程的方法包括面向过程编程、面向对象编程和函数式编程,操作流程包括分析需求、设计算法、编写代码、调试测试、优化改进、部署上线和维护更新。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部